Lunch at Norman High is quick and easy due to its close proximity to tons of places to eat. Here are the top 10 based on location and food options.
#1 Taco Casa (4.4 Star rating)
You can go right next door to Taco Casa and get some quick tex-mex.
#2 Starbucks (4.1 Star rating)
Starbucks is a short walk across the street. This is a great place to grab a snack and drink with a wide variety of options.
#3 Cici’s Pizza (3.8 Star rating)
On a budget? Cici’s is the perfect place to grab lunch with all you can eat pizza, pasta, and salad.
#4 Chick-fil-A (4.4 Star rating)
Chick-fil-A is just a short drive down main street. They have tons of options aside from just chicken.
#5 Freddy’s (4.4 Star Rating)
Freddy’s Frozen Custard & Steakburgers is around the same distance as Chick-Fil-A. They have burgers, Chicken, and Ice cream.
#6 Raising Cane’s (4.4 Star Rating)
Cane’s is quite a bit farther, but still close enough to get food and get back on time.
#7 Sprouts (4.4 Star rating)
Some students opt for sprouts if they don’t want fast food. You can get sushi, smaller snacks like chips, premade sandwiches or wraps, etc.
#8 Main Street Donuts (4.8 Star rating)
You can go right across the street and can grab great donuts or sandwiches.
#9 Dutch Bros (4.4 Star rating)
Many students go to Dutch Bros for lunch. While they don’t have as many food options, they have great drinks!
#10 McDonald’s (3.3 Star Rating)
In last place, we have McDonald’s. McDonald’s is a very popular, easy choice and only a couple of streets away.
